In Memory of Her

In Mark 14 and Matthew 26 we read of Jesus being anointed by a woman while visiting the home of a man called Simon the Leper. The story ends with Jesus’ words, “Truly I tell you, wherever this gospel is preached throughout the world, what she has done will also be told, in memory of her” (Matthew 26:13, TNIV).

We should take Jesus’ comment seriously and thus look for ways to remember and honor this woman. Below is one such way–a prayer to be read in response to this gospel story.

“Great God, Lord of lepers, Prince of peasants, you who are Lord of both wealth and poverty, you who make possible every beautiful act: We thank you for this storied woman, for her boldness and her humility, for her loving act and her lavish gift. We thank you for her life, though to us it remains in shadows; we thank you all the more for the events her scandalous story foreshadowed. May we, like she, glimpse your glory. May we, like she, play our part in the gospel story. Amen.”
